Zeolites for nuclear waste treatment: Co, Ni and Zn uptake into synthetic faujasite X
Authors:A Dyer  J K Abou-Jamous
Institution:1. Chemical Science Research Institute, University of Salford, Cockcroft Building, M5 4WT, Salford, UK
Abstract:Pellets of the synthetic zeolite X were loaded with the radioisotopes60Co,63Ni and65Zn. The pellets were then calcined. A secondary ion-exchange step introduced a large cation, barium, into the zeolites with a view to blocking the release of the radioisotopes under leaching conditions. Leaching was carried out over 84 days with synthetic sea and ground waters as well as deionised water. Leach tests were evaluated in terms of cumulative fraction of isotopes released and as diffusion coefficients derived from leaching profiles. Cobalt containing samples were cement encapsulated and further leach studies carried out. Some minor reduction in isotopes release was observed in the presence of barium but this was not consistent.
